Windham township is located in Bradford County, Pennsylvania. Windham township has a 2025 population of 811. Windham township is currently declining at a rate of -0.25% annually and its population has decreased by -1.1%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 820 in 2020.

The average household income in Windham township is $75,315 with a poverty rate of 10.84%.The median age in Windham township is 42.6 years: 45.2 years for males, and 41.4 years for females.

Demographics

The racial composition of Windham township includes 92.77% White, and smaller percentages for Black or African American, Asian and multiracial populations.

Economics and Income Statistics

Windham township's average per capita income is $45,417. Household income levels show a median of $60,625. The poverty rate stands at 10.84%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
